240,701 is an odd 6-digit integer and a prime number. It has 2 divisors and a digital root of 5.

#240701 is a red with RGB values 36, 7, 1 and HSL 10°, 95%, 7%. It is a dark colour, so white text on it reaches 19:1 contrast (AAA for normal text). The nearest named colour is Black.
